Q: Is 95,080 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 95,080 is a composite number.

Why is 95,080 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 95,080 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 40 2,377 4,754 9,508 11,885 19,016 23,770 47,540 and 95,080, with no remainder.

Since 95,080 cannot be divided by just 1 and 95,080, it is a composite number.
